What is the TCF Exam?
The TCF Exam Registration Fee is a standardized test designed to evaluate the French language skills of non-native speakers. It evaluates candidates throughout 4 primary locations: listening comprehension, checking out comprehension, speaking, and composing. Each section ratings candidates on a scale from A1 (newbie) to C2 (skilled), lined up with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R).

Signing up for the TCF exam online is a straightforward procedure. Below are the typical actions included:
Step 1: Visit the Official Website
Candidates need to navigate to the official TCF examination website, where they can discover all required information about the examination.
Action 2: Create an Account
If this is your very first time registering, you will need to create an account. This normally includes:
Providing personal info (Name, Email, etc)Creating a passwordAgreeing to termsStep 3: Select Exam Type
Select which TCF examination you wish to take-- for example, TCF for Academic Purposes (TCF TP) or the TCF for Residency (TCF Exam Booking DAP).
Step 4: Choose Date and Location
Select your favored exam date and location from an available list. It's recommended to book your spot early due to limited availability.
Step 5: Complete Payment
The majority of registrations require an assessment charge. Guarantee that you utilize a secure payment technique, as the site will redirect you to a payment website.
Step 6: Confirmation
After payment, prospects will get a confirmation email with information about the exam, such as the date, time, and area. Save this for future recommendation.
Step 7: Prepare for the Exam
With your registration complete, it's time to prepare for the TCF. Lots of resources are offered, consisting of practice tests, online courses, and research study materials.
